Output 3cca360008743216876a8eb29bbf0ea8d080ddd57dd84f2895c1dca62ad9052d:0

value
1332272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c01e18059dd0611aab1f90914b20edcb52f09f OP_EQUAL
address
32DRT4hVQZJG17ip1XpEQkVaLXAoixUa9Q
transaction
3cca360008743216876a8eb29bbf0ea8d080ddd57dd84f2895c1dca62ad9052d
confirmations
418161
spent
true